    "headline": "Supreme Court Suspends Six-Month Jail Sentence for YouTube Star Gulshan Pahuja",
    "dek": "India's Supreme Court suspended the six-month jail sentence of YouTuber Gulshan Pahuja for contempt of court pending a future hearing.",
    "prose": "The Supreme Court of India suspended the six-month jail sentence imposed on YouTuber Gulshan Pahuja for contempt of court pending a future hearing. [^1]\n\nDelhi High Court had convicted YouTuber Gulshan Pahuja for contempt of court and sentenced him to six months of simple imprisonment. [^2]\n\nThe Delhi High Court found that Gulshan Pahuja made scandalous comments about the judiciary in his videos and arguments, stating that the arbitrariness of courts is increasing and likening it to dictatorship. [^3]\n\nThe Supreme Court bench comprising Justices Dipankar Datta and Sheel Nagu agreed to hear the appeal filed by Gulshan Pahuja challenging the Delhi High Court's orders. [^4]",
